Output 8530460affcdcb67ce9744f925893b230aab3093a20cbf41d802597ea0379d23:0

value
1214168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e772e14bc6ce1b8604f19e2bcd21434d5d4332 OP_EQUAL
address
3HBPPJbY6rxK7AU7KEWVTkUGgWyQ1V56Up
transaction
8530460affcdcb67ce9744f925893b230aab3093a20cbf41d802597ea0379d23
confirmations
274672
spent
true